怎么做网站采集数据分析
-
已被采纳为最佳回答
要进行网站采集数据分析,首先要明确数据采集的目标、选择合适的工具、遵守相关法律法规、确保数据的准确性和完整性、分析数据并得出结论。明确数据采集的目标是至关重要的,只有清晰了解想要收集哪些数据,才能有效选择合适的工具与方法。数据采集的目标可以包括了解用户行为、行业趋势、竞争对手分析等。通过明确的目标,才能确保数据采集的有效性和分析的针对性。接下来,将对相关的工具、法律法规、数据准确性及分析方法进行深入探讨。
一、明确数据采集的目标
确定数据采集的目标是整个数据分析流程的第一步。企业或个人在进行数据采集前,需仔细思考所希望达成的具体目的。常见的数据采集目标包括市场趋势分析、用户行为研究、竞争对手监测、产品反馈收集等。以市场趋势分析为例,企业可以通过收集行业相关数据,了解市场的动态变化,制定相应的市场策略。此外,用户行为研究可以帮助企业了解用户在网站上的点击路径、停留时间等,进而优化网站布局和内容,提升用户体验。明确目标后,企业可以针对性地选择合适的数据采集工具和方法,确保数据采集的有效性和针对性。
二、选择合适的数据采集工具
在确定了数据采集的目标后,选择合适的数据采集工具至关重要。市场上有众多的数据采集工具,能够满足不同的需求。其中,Scrapy、Beautiful Soup、Octoparse、ParseHub等是常用的网页数据采集工具。Scrapy是一个强大的Python框架,适合进行大规模数据采集,具有高效、灵活的特点;Beautiful Soup则适合进行简单的数据采集,尤其是处理HTML和XML文档时非常方便。Octoparse和ParseHub则是无代码工具,适合没有编程基础的用户使用,提供了可视化的操作界面。选择工具时,需要考虑数据量、采集频率、技术背景及预算等因素,以便选择最符合需求的工具。
三、遵循法律法规
在进行网站数据采集时,遵循相关法律法规是非常重要的。各国对数据采集有不同的法律规定,违反这些规定可能会导致法律责任和经济损失。在中国,数据采集必须遵循《网络安全法》《个人信息保护法》等相关法律,确保不侵犯他人的合法权益。尤其是在采集用户个人信息时,必须得到用户的明确同意。此外,网站的robots.txt文件中也会指出哪些内容是允许采集的,遵循这些规则不仅是法律要求,也是对网站所有者的尊重。为了避免法律风险,建议在进行数据采集前,了解相关法律法规,并确保采集活动的合规性。
四、确保数据的准确性和完整性
数据的准确性和完整性直接影响到数据分析的结果,因此在数据采集过程中,需要采取有效措施确保数据质量。可以通过多种方式提高数据的准确性,例如使用定期更新的数据源、对比多个数据源、进行数据清洗等。数据清洗是指对收集到的数据进行整理、处理,去除重复、错误或不完整的数据,以确保最终分析的数据是准确的。此外,还可以使用数据验证技术,如交叉验证等方法,进一步提高数据的可信度。只有确保数据的准确性和完整性,才能为后续的分析提供可靠依据,从而得出科学的结论。
五、进行数据分析
数据采集完成后,下一步是进行数据分析。数据分析可以采用多种方法,包括描述性分析、探索性分析、推断性分析等。描述性分析主要用于总结和描述数据的基本特征,如计算均值、标准差、频率分布等;探索性分析则用于发现数据中的潜在模式和关系,例如使用可视化工具展示数据的分布情况,帮助发现异常值和趋势;推断性分析则通过统计方法对样本数据进行推断,以了解总体特征和趋势。数据分析的目标是从数据中提取有用的信息,以支持决策和优化策略。在数据分析过程中,使用合适的工具和技术,如Python、R、Excel等,可以提高分析的效率和准确性。
六、数据可视化
数据可视化是数据分析的重要环节,能够将复杂的数据以直观的方式呈现,帮助决策者更快地理解数据。通过使用图表、仪表盘等可视化工具,可以清晰地展示数据的趋势、分布和关系。常用的可视化工具包括Tableau、Power BI、Matplotlib、Seaborn等。可视化不仅可以提高数据的可读性,还能够帮助发现数据中的潜在问题和机会。例如,通过制作折线图,可以直观地查看某一指标随时间的变化趋势;通过散点图,可以观察两个变量之间的关系。数据可视化的目的是将数据转化为直观的图形,帮助企业在决策时更加科学和合理。
七、制定优化策略
通过数据分析和可视化,企业可以得出相应的结论,并制定优化策略。优化策略可以包括网站内容的调整、用户体验的改进、市场营销活动的优化等。例如,如果通过数据分析发现某一页面的跳出率较高,企业可以考虑优化该页面的内容和设计,以提高用户的留存率。此外,还可以根据用户的行为数据,制定个性化的营销策略,提高转化率。在制定优化策略时,企业应结合数据分析的结果,考虑市场趋势、用户需求等多个因素,以确保策略的有效性和可行性。
八、定期监测与调整
数据采集和分析并不是一次性的工作,而是一个持续的过程。企业应定期监测关键指标,分析数据变化的原因,并根据市场环境的变化及时调整策略。定期监测可以帮助企业及时发现潜在问题,及时采取措施进行调整。例如,如果发现某一市场的用户行为发生了显著变化,企业需要迅速分析原因,并调整市场策略以适应新的变化。此外,企业还可以利用A/B测试等手段,持续优化网站和营销策略,确保在竞争激烈的市场环境中保持优势。通过定期监测与调整,企业能够实现数据驱动的决策,提高市场竞争力。
九、总结与展望
网站数据采集与分析是一个系统性过程,需要明确目标、选择合适工具、遵循法律法规、确保数据质量、进行深入分析、可视化展示,并制定优化策略。随着技术的不断进步,数据采集与分析的工具和方法也在不断发展,企业应保持对新技术的关注,及时更新数据采集与分析的方法,以提高数据的使用效率和准确性。未来,随着人工智能和大数据技术的不断发展,网站数据采集与分析将迎来更广阔的应用前景。企业应积极拥抱这些技术,提升自身的数据分析能力,从而在激烈的市场竞争中立于不败之地。
1年前 -
做网站数据采集和分析是一个非常重要的过程,这有助于了解用户行为、优化网站内容以及制定营销策略。以下是一些具体步骤和方法来进行网站数据采集和分析:
-
确定数据采集的目标和范围:
- 首先,明确定义你要采集和分析的数据范围,包括哪些指标和数据类型是最关键的。
- 设置清晰的目标,比如增加网站访问量、提高用户转化率、优化页面加载速度等。
-
选择合适的工具和技术:
- 选择适合你网站需求的数据采集工具,比如Google Analytics、Kissmetrics、Mixpanel等。
- 了解不同工具的功能和优缺点,选取最适合你的工具进行数据采集。
-
添加跟踪代码和标签:
- 在网站的各个页面中添加跟踪代码和标签,这些代码会帮助你追踪用户访问和行为数据。
- 确保代码正确设置,跟踪页面浏览量、点击率、用户停留时间等关键指标。
-
收集和存储数据:
- 数据采集完成后,数据会被发送到数据库或云服务器中进行存储。
- 确保数据的准确性和完整性,及时清理和备份数据,以便后续分析和使用。
-
数据分析和报告:
- 利用数据分析工具和技术,深入挖掘数据,发现用户行为模式和趋势。
- 生成报告和可视化图表,用于展示数据分析结果,并为决策提供支持。
通过以上步骤,你可以建立起一个完整的网站数据采集和分析流程,从而更好地了解用户需求、优化网站体验,提升网站业绩。
1年前 -
-
网站数据采集和分析是一项重要的工作,可以帮助你了解用户行为、优化网站体验、提升营销效果等。下面我将简要介绍如何进行网站数据采集和分析的步骤。
1. 确定数据采集目标:
首先,你需要明确自己的数据采集目标是什么。是了解用户访问行为?优化用户体验?还是提升营销效果?根据不同的目标来确定需要采集的数据类型和指标。
2. 选择合适的数据采集工具:
根据你的数据采集目标,选择合适的数据采集工具。常用的工具包括Google Analytics、百度统计、友盟等。这些工具提供了丰富的数据采集功能,可以帮助你实时监控网站数据。
3. 部署数据采集代码:
将选定的数据采集工具提供的代码部署到你的网站上。这些代码通常是一段JavaScript代码,可以放在你网站的每个页面中。通过这些代码,数据采集工具可以追踪用户访问行为、页面浏览量等数据。
4. 设置数据采集目标和事件:
设置数据采集工具的目标和事件,以便更好地监测用户行为。比如,你可以设置“注册”、“下单”等目标,或者通过事件追踪用户在网站上的具体操作,如点击按钮、播放视频等。
5. 分析数据和生成报告:
定期分析采集到的数据,生成报告。通过数据分析,你可以了解用户访问路径、用户行为偏好、页面流量等信息,从而优化网站内容和功能,提升用户体验和营销效果。
6. 优化网站体验和营销策略:
根据数据分析的结果,优化网站体验和营销策略。比如,你可以调整网站布局、优化关键页面内容、改进营销活动等,以提升用户满意度和转化率。
7. 持续优化和监测:
数据采集和分析是一个持续的过程,你需要不断优化网站和营销策略,同时持续监测数据变化。通过持续的数据分析和优化,可以不断提升网站的效果和用户体验。
综上所述,网站数据采集和分析是一个重要而复杂的工作,需要系统地规划和执行。通过合理的数据采集和分析,可以帮助你更好地了解用户行为,优化网站体验,提升营销效果。希望以上内容对你有所帮助,祝你在网站数据采集和分析工作中取得成功!
1年前 -
如何进行网站数据采集与分析
在当今信息爆炸的时代,通过网站数据采集与分析可以帮助企业更好地了解用户行为、市场趋势,做出更有效的决策。本文将从网站数据采集的方法、数据分析的流程以及一些常用的工具与技术等方面进行详细介绍。
一、网站数据采集
1. 网站数据采集的方法
-
爬虫技术:利用网络爬虫对网站的内容进行抓取,常见的爬虫工具包括Scrapy、BeautifulSoup等。
-
API接口:有些网站提供API接口,可以通过接口直接获取数据,这种方式一般更加稳定和便捷。
-
数据访问日志:对于自有网站或者有权限的网站,可以通过访问日志进行数据采集。
2. 网站数据采集的注意事项
-
数据来源合法:在进行数据采集时,务必要遵守相关法律法规,避免侵犯他人的合法权益。
-
尊重网站规则:在进行数据采集时,应当尊重网站的爬虫协议,避免对网站造成不必要的负担。
二、网站数据分析
1. 数据收集与清洗
-
数据收集:将采集到的数据进行整理,包括去重、筛选等操作,确保数据的完整性和准确性。
-
数据清洗:清洗数据,处理缺失值、异常值等,使数据更具可分析性。
2. 数据探索与分析
-
数据可视化:利用数据可视化工具如Matplotlib、Tableau等,将数据可视化成图表,更直观地展现数据之间的联系。
-
数据探索:通过统计分析、关联分析、聚类分析等方法,深入挖掘数据背后的规律与信息。
3. 数据建模与预测
-
特征工程:对数据进行特征提取、降维等操作,提高数据的表征能力。
-
建模与预测:利用机器学习、深度学习等技术,构建模型进行数据预测、分类等任务。
三、常用工具与技术
1. 数据采集工具
-
Scrapy:一个Python的开源网络爬虫框架,用于快速高效地从网站上提取数据。
-
BeautifulSoup:一个Python的HTML和XML解析库,可以方便地提取所需的数据。
2. 数据分析工具
-
Python:Python语言在数据分析领域有着广泛的应用,如NumPy、Pandas、Matplotlib等库。
-
R语言:R语言同样是数据分析的重要工具,拥有丰富的数据分析包。
3. 可视化工具
-
Tableau:一款功能强大且易于上手的数据可视化工具,可以快速生成各种图表和仪表盘。
-
Power BI:微软推出的数据分析和商业智能工具,集成了数据整理、可视化、数据建模等功能。
四、总结
通过网站数据采集与分析,企业可以更好地了解用户需求、产品市场等信息,辅助决策、制定营销策略等。在实际应用中,除了掌握相应的技术和工具,还需要不断学习和实践,才能更好地运用数据分析带来的价值。
1年前 -